About
A curated list of unicorn startup companies, which are defined in finance as privately held startup companies currently valued at US$1 billion or more. This data captures these high-valuation enterprises across technology centers globally. The information is often compiled and maintained by notable financial publications such as The Wall Street Journal, Fortune Magazine, and TechCrunch, and is essential for market tracking and investment analysis.
Columns
The dataset contains six fields detailing the characteristics and status of each unicorn company:
- Company: The official name of the startup company. All records are valid.
- Valuation (US$ billions): The current valuation assigned to the company, expressed in US dollars and billions.
- Valuation date: The specific date on which the recorded valuation was confirmed for the respective company.
- Industry: The sector or industry to which the company belongs. Note that approximately 11% of records in this column are missing information.
- Country/countries: The primary country or countries associated with the company’s operations or headquarters.
- Founder(s): The name(s) of the founder(s) of the company. This field has a high rate of missing data, with around 81% of records currently not containing founder details.
Distribution
This collection is delivered in a tabular format, typically a CSV file, and contains six distinct columns. There are approximately 635 individual records or rows detailing the unicorn companies. The file size is small, recorded as 36.24 kB.

Coverage
The scope of this data is worldwide, detailing unicorn companies found across technology hubs globally. The data is planned for an annual update frequency, ensuring relatively current information on company valuations.
